MGP Ingredients Announces Leadership Transition Amid Industry Challenges
MGP Ingredients, Inc. (Nasdaq: MGPI), a key player in the alcohol spirits sector, reveals significant leadership changes aimed at fortifying its position in a challenging market. Effective January 1, 2025, Brandon Gall, the company's current Chief Financial Officer, is appointed as the Interim President and Chief Executive Officer, succeeding David Bratcher, who will resign from the Board of Directors at the end of 2024 and plans to retire thereafter. Gall, who has been with MGP since 2012, brings extensive financial acumen and strategic insight, having served as CFO since April 2019. His familiarity with MGP’s operations positions him well to lead the company through this transitional phase.
The company’s Board has also appointed Donn Lux as the new Chairman, succeeding Karen Seaberg. Lux, a current Board member, is tasked with spearheading the search for a permanent CEO, focusing on both internal and external candidates. In addition to these leadership shifts, MGP Ingredients is also facing legal challenges, with a class action lawsuit filed by Glancy Prongay & Murray LLP on behalf of investors who purchased shares between May 4, 2023, and October 30, 2024. The lawsuit stems from significant sales declines reported by the company, including a 24% drop in Q3 2024 compared to the previous year. Investors are encouraged to file motions by February 14, 2025, to participate in the proceedings.
